Bowler 是一个 RESTful, 多通道的 Scala 的 Web 框架,使用函数式编程风格,构建在 Scalatra 和 Scalate 的基础之上,使用 Lift-JSON 处理 JSON 数据。它拥有以下特性:
ReactiveMongo 是一个NOSQL MongoDB 的 Scala 驱动,提供完整的非堵塞和异步 I/O 操作。 运行一个简单的查询: package foo import reactivemongo
Metascala 是使用 Scala 编写的极小 metacircular Java Virtual Machine (JVM) 。Metascala 大约有 300 行的 Scala 代码,但是是完整的 JVM,可以解析自己。使用
Scala开发NetBeans插件。支持: 语法和语义着色 源代码大纲导航器 代码折叠 变量高亮显示 转至声明 即时重命名 代码缩进 代码格式 错误注解 代码自动完成 收录时间:2010-11-25
摘要 Scala 是一种融合了面向对象和函数式编程的静态类型语言,他被定位为构建组件及组件系统。本文是 Scala 语言的概述,适合于理解编程方法和熟悉程序语言设计的读者阅读。 1 简介 真正
scala 从入门到入门+ 新手向,面向刚从java过渡到scala的同学,目的是写出已已易于维护和阅读的代码. 从语句到表达式 语句(statement): 一段可执行的代码表达式(expression):
官网/论坛/专题 Scala官方网站 Scala官方Wiki ScalaCn论坛 ScalaCn邮件列表 Scala Fish - 斯卡拉魚 (中国台湾的Scala邮件列表) Nabble
Scala编程语言近来抓住了很多开发者的眼球。如果你粗略浏览Scala的网站,你会觉得Scala是一种纯粹的面向对象编程语言,而又无缝地结合了命令式和函数式的编程风格。 Christopher Diggins认为:
我所知道的Scala持久层框架有: 1、 Slick (typesafe出品) 2、 Squeryl 3、 Anorm(Play的持久层) 4、 ScalaActiveRecord (基于Squeryl之上)
Sangria 是GraphQL的Scala实现。 示例代码: { "data": { "hero": { "name": "R2-D2", "friends": [ { "name": "Luke
这是我去年在一个Scala项目中结合一些参考资料和项目实践整理的一份编码规范,基于的Scala版本为2.10,但同时也适用于2.11版本。参考资料见文后。整个编码规范分为如下六个部分: 1. 格式与命名
来自: http://colobu.com/2016/02/15/Scala-Async/ 在我以前的文章中,我介绍了 Scala Future and Promise 。 Future 代表一个
英文原文: Yammer Moving from Scala to Java 近日,由 Yammer 雇员 Coda Hale 发给 Typesafe 的 Scala 商业管理层的 邮件 通过 YCombinator
Scala 比 Java 还快? 通常Scala被认为比Java要慢,特别是用于函数式编程时。本文会解释为什么这个被广泛接受的假设是错误的。 数据验证 编程中一个常见的问题是数据验证。即我们要
当面向对象遇到函数式编程,这就是Scala。简练的语言描述与简单的例子相辅相成,希望能够对大家学习Scala有所帮助。 定义 Scala语言是一种面向对象语言,同时又结合了命令式(impe
装 Breeze —Scala用的数值处理库 Chalk—自然语言处理库。 FACTORIE—可部署的概率建模工具包,用Scala实现的软件库。为用户提供简洁的语言来创建关系因素图,评估参数并进行推断。
Casbah 是 Mongodb 官方的 Scala 驱动程序包。 MongoDB 是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。他支持的数
Kestrel 是 Scala 的一个非常小的队列系统,基于 starling。 fast It runs on the JVM so it can take advantage of the
Twitter提供的 Scala School :讲解简洁,可以作为快速入门 Twitter编写的如何有效开发Scala的文档—— Effective Scala 一个非常棒的 Scala网上教程 :可以直接在网页上修改程序和运行程序
列出了采用Scala语言进行开发时的最佳实践建议,总共分为5大类: ①Hygienic Rules ②Language Rules ③Application Architecture ④Concurrency